Tennis elbow rehabilitation exercise method

Tennis elbow is clinically known as humeral epicondylitis, which is a sterile inflammation produced by repeated stretching of the extensor tendon stop. For patients suffering from tennis elbow, the local symptoms can be relieved through rehabilitation functional training, the main methods are resistance back extension training, flexion wrist stretching training, etc., as follows: 1. Resistance back extension training: the patient and family members stand facing each other, the patient makes a fist with force to do wrist back extension action, the family members place their hands on the back part of the patient’s hand, press down the fist that is being back extended with force to do resistance exercise, insist on 1-2 minutes; 2. Wrist flexion and stretching training: the patient does the wrist flexion action, clenches the fist with force, the other hand grabs the fist, makes the fist flex to the outside, and then does the stretching action.
